    Why go

    Al Borgo is a sensible central Vienna booking when convenience matters more than a destination dining brief. Choose it for an easy meal in the First District; look elsewhere if the priority is a documented wine program, named chef, awards signal, or a clearly defined tasting format.

    About Al Borgo

    Is Al Borgo worth booking in Vienna? It can be, if the priority is a straightforward meal that fits the venue's opening pattern. Al Borgo is in Vienna, follows a smart casual dress code, serves lunch and dinner Monday to Friday, opens for dinner on Saturday, is closed Sunday.

    A Vienna choice for low-pressure planning

    The strongest reason to keep this on the shortlist is scheduling. Monday to Friday hours are 11:30 AM–3 PM and 6–11 PM, while Saturday is 6–11 PM. For a wider scan before committing, compare it with Our full Vienna restaurants guide, then narrow by how much structure the meal needs.

    For drinks-focused diners, check the current list directly before making it the anchor of the night. The safer recommendation is to book for the timing and overall fit. Pair it with research from Our full Vienna bars guide if drinks depth is the main goal.

    Who should choose it over a more defined brief

    Book this for a flexible Vienna meal when the group wants lunch availability Monday to Friday or dinner availability Monday to Saturday.     The take

    The Take

    The Vibe

    Al Borgo reads like a quietly confident Italian address in Vienna’s Innere Stadt. It intentionally locates itself within the city’s fine-dining geography without courting the tourist circuit, which gives the dining room a tucked‑away, urbane feeling. The copy positions the kitchen in conversation with established local peers, so the experience skews tasteful and composed rather than flashy. Expect an environment that privileges culinary refinement and neighborhood discretion: polished and classic in manner, with the measured restraint you’d associate with a refined Italian table serving an attentive city clientèle.

    Best For

    This is a dinner‑forward choice for occasions that require a degree of formality: date nights, business dinners and special celebrations all sit comfortably here. The restaurant’s placement in Vienna’s first district and the way it is discussed alongside high‑end peers signal a setting meant for considered evenings rather than quick meals. Parties seeking a refined, low‑profile spot to mark an anniversary or to host visiting clients will find the tone appropriate; reservations are recommended for key nights given its position among the city’s compact peer group.

    Ordering Tips

    Lean into the signatures listed on the menu. The Spaghetti di Mare and Grilled Mixed Fish showcase the kitchen’s seafood strengths and speak to a coastal Italian thread; the Truffle Pasta is clearly a richer, more indulgent option. Finish with the classical Tiramisu for a straightforward, well‑known dessert. Given the menu highlights, diners who appreciate precise execution of Italian classics and seafood-focused plates should prioritize those items when ordering.

    Restaurant context

    How Al Borgo compares in Vienna

    Choose Al Borgo when the brief is central, easy, low-pressure. Against Loca, it reads as the safer convenience play rather than the more intentional dining choice; pick Loca when the meal itself needs to carry the evening, pick Al Borgo when location and flexibility are doing the work.

    Kao Soi Thai Bistro and Le viet are better cross-shops when the group wants a more specific cuisine direction. Al Borgo makes more sense for mixed preferences or a less planned meal, while those two are stronger choices when the craving is the decision.

    For atmosphere-led plans, compare it with Atelier 7 Brasserie and Atelier 7 The Café. The Brasserie is the more natural pick for a fuller sit-down occasion; the Café is better for a lighter, less formal stop. Al Borgo sits between those use cases: easier than a special-occasion booking, more meal-focused than a quick café plan.
